WebMay 24, 2024 · Urticaria and angioedema can be classified as follows: Acute urticaria - short lived bouts of urticaria. Chronic spontaneous urticaria (formerly known as chronic ordinary urticaria or chronic idiopathic urticaria) - a chronic urticaria that lasts for over six weeks, and may persist for months and in some cases years. WebChronic spontaneous urticaria in children is often a vexing problem for the provider and at best a frustrating one for many parents. Its presence can have a significant impact on the well-being and quality of life for the child and immediate family. The need for and type of testing are guided by a detailed history and physical exam. WebApr 4, 2024 · Urticaria in children can be either acute (often gone within hours to days) or chronic (lasting longer than 6 weeks). In children, acute urticaria is much more common than chronic urticaria. About 40% of children with acute urticaria also have angioedema. What is urticaria?.
